Abstract
The utility model discloses a kind of jig guide plate abrasion-proof structure with lubricant coating, including guide plate ontology, the guide plate ontology is equipped with weight loss groove, the guide plate outer body is equipped with accommodating groove, slot is equipped between the accommodating groove and guide plate ontology, absorption layer is equipped with inside the accommodating groove, the absorption layer outer wall is equipped with connection strap, connection sheet is equipped with slot junction on the inside of the connection strap, the connection sheet is equipped with fixation hole, it is equipped with wear-resisting salient point on the outside of the connection strap, fixing screws are equipped between the guide plate ontology and fixation hole.The utility model is by being equipped with connection strap and wear-resisting salient point, the setting of multiple wear-resisting salient points can utilize the cross sectional shape of abrasion resistant convex null circle arc, be driven similar to ball type, if more serious abrasion occurs for wear-resisting salient point after a period of time to be used, user only needs to loosen fixing screws, connection sheet is taken out out of slot, completes the separation of connection strap and accommodating groove, the connection strap more renewed.

The utility model provides a kind of jig guide plate abrasion-proof structure with lubricant coating as shown in Figs 1-4, including leads
Plate ontology 1, the guide plate ontology 1 are equipped with weight loss groove 2, are equipped with accommodating groove 3 on the outside of the guide plate ontology 1, the accommodating groove 3 with
It is equipped with slot 4 between guide plate ontology 1, absorption layer 5 is equipped with inside the accommodating groove 3,5 outer wall of absorption layer is equipped with connection strap 6,
6 inside of connection strap is equipped with connection sheet 7 with 4 junction of slot, and the connection sheet 7 is equipped with fixation hole 8, the connection strap 6
Outside is equipped with wear-resisting salient point 9, and fixing screws 10 are equipped between the guide plate ontology 1 and fixation hole 8, and the connection strap 6 is equipped with
Oil seepage slot 11.
Further, in the above-mentioned technical solutions, the quantity of the wear-resisting salient point 9 and oil seepage slot 11 is disposed as multiple,
Multiple wear-resisting salient points 9 and the setting of the interval of oil seepage slot 11;
Further, in the above-mentioned technical solutions, the fixation hole 8 runs through connection sheet 7, described 7 one end of connection sheet and company
Narrow bars 6 are integrally formed, and the connection strap 6 is adapted with slot 4, if after a period of time to be used wear-resisting salient point 9 occur it is more serious
Abrasion, user only needs to loosen fixing screws 10, connection sheet 7 taken out out of slot 4, completes connection strap 6 and accommodating groove 3
Separation, the connection strap 6 more renewed;
Further, in the above-mentioned technical solutions, the wear-resisting salient point 9 is integrally formed with connection strap 6, multiple described wear-resisting
9 cross sectional shape of salient point is set as arc-shaped, and the height of the wear-resisting salient point 9 is greater than the depth of accommodating groove 3, and sliding part is in guide plate sheet
It is contacted when being slided on body 1 with wear-resisting salient point 9, more traditional entirety with guide plate ontology 1 contacts, the setting of multiple wear-resisting salient points 9
The contact area of sliding part Yu guide plate ontology 1 can be not only reduced, gearing friction power is reduced, additionally it is possible to utilize wear-resisting 9 circular arc of salient point
The cross sectional shape of shape be driven similar to ball type;
Further, in the above-mentioned technical solutions, the absorption layer 5 is adapted with accommodating groove 3, and the absorption layer 5 is by sea
Continuous material is made, and absorption layer 5 absorbs oil droplet and stored, and can not only prevent grunge pollution processing environment from increasing the cleaning of user
Work, additionally it is possible to form an oil lamella in accommodating groove 3, reduce the corrosion rate of guide plate ontology 1;
Further, in the above-mentioned technical solutions, the weight loss groove 2 is longitudinal runs through guide plate ontology 1, and the oil seepage slot 11 is vertical
To connection strap 6 is run through, the grease stain that driving member is dripped when being driven on guide plate ontology 1 can be inhaled through oil seepage slot 11 by absorption layer 5
It receives;
Further, in the above-mentioned technical solutions, 1 surface layer of guide plate ontology is equipped with lubricant coating, the lubricant coating
It is set as tungsten disulfide lubricant coating, the service life of guide plate ontology 1 can be improved in the setting of lubricant coating, increases wear-resistant strong
Degree.
This practical working principle:
In use, referring to Figure of description 1-4, weight loss groove 2 can reduce this jig guide plate abrasion-proof structure with lubricant coating
The self weight of guide plate ontology 1 reduces materials'use and convenient for users to moving to guide plate ontology 1, and sliding part is in guide plate ontology 1
It is contacted when upper sliding with wear-resisting salient point 9, more traditional entirety with guide plate ontology 1 contacts, and the setting of multiple wear-resisting salient points 9 is not only
The contact area of sliding part Yu guide plate ontology 1 can be reduced, gearing friction power is reduced, additionally it is possible to is arc-shaped using wear-resisting salient point 9
Cross sectional shape be driven similar to ball type, if more serious mill occurs for wear-resisting salient point 9 after a period of time to be used
Damage, user only need to loosen fixing screws 10, connection sheet 7 are taken out out of slot 4, complete point of connection strap 6 and accommodating groove 3
From the connection strap 6 more renewed;
Referring to Figure of description 3, the grease stain that driving member is dripped when being driven on guide plate ontology 1 can be through oil seepage slot 11 by inhaling
Attached pad 5 is absorbed, and absorption layer 5 absorbs oil droplet and stored, and can not only prevent grunge pollution processing environment from increasing user's
Cleaning work, additionally it is possible to form an oil lamella in accommodating groove 3, reduce the corrosion rate of guide plate ontology 1.
